This is my first time getting out un guided and I have limited knowledge so please take this in consideration when reading this less than technically eloquent report.
We started the day in the thick trees and made our way up on what seemed to be a supportive snow pack. There was a nice new layer of snow on top. When poking my pole to the earth, I could feel 3 layers: soft/crust/soft. Overall cover was about 40cm.
When we go to the point where it was actually time to ski down, I realised I had a binding malfunctions and could not fix it to ski down so we had to skin back to the parking lot.
